前言
在前端开发中,我们经常需要用到各种各样的工具库和框架来辅助我们开发。而 npm 是一个非常重要的工具,它可以让我们很方便地安装和管理各种各样的包,其中就包括了 lodash-vision。
lodash-vision 是基于 lodash 的一款轻量级 JavaScript 工具库,它提供了一系列非常实用的方法来帮助我们开发。本文将详细介绍如何安装和使用 lodash-vision 这个包。
安装
我们可以通过 npm 命令来安装 lodash-vision 包:
npm install lodash-vision
安装完成后我们就可以在我们的项目中使用 lodash-vision 了。
使用方法
lodash-vision 提供了大量的有用方法,下面我们来介绍几个常用的方法。
1. get
get 方法可以帮助我们获取对象中的属性值,如果值不存在,可以设置一个默认值。
示例代码:
const _ = require('lodash-vision'); const obj = {a:{b:'c'}}; const value = _.get(obj, 'a.b', 'defaultValue'); console.log(value); //"c"
2. findIndex
findIndex 方法可以帮助我们找到数组中符合条件的元素的索引。
示例代码:
const _ = require('lodash-vision'); const arr = [1, 2, 3, 4, 5]; const index = _.findIndex(arr, (num) => num % 2 === 0); console.log(index); //1
3. debounce
debounce 方法可以帮助我们在一定时间内防止重复触发函数。
示例代码:
-- -------------------- ---- ------- ----- - - ------------------------- -------- ------ ----- - ---------------- - ----- ----------- - ------------------ ------ --------------------- --------------------- ----------------------------- -- - ---- ---------------
4. throttle
throttle 方法可以帮助我们限制函数的触发频率。
示例代码:
-- -------------------- ---- ------- ----- - - ------------------------- -------- ------ ----- - ---------------- - ----- ----------- - ------------------ ------ --------------------- --------------------- ----------------------------- -- -- - ---------- -------- ---------------
总结
本文介绍了如何安装和使用 lodash-vision 这个包,同时也介绍了一些常用的方法。在实际开发中,我们可以根据需要选择合适的方法来帮助我们开发。这些方法都非常实用,可以极大地提高我们的开发效率。
来源:JavaScript中文网 ,转载请注明来源 https://www.javascriptcn.com/post/lodash-vision